Avantages et inconvénients du MBR
Avantages du MBR
- MBR peut être utilisé dans de nombreux anciens systèmes d’exploitation tels que Windows XP,Windows 7, et divers systèmes basés sur BIOS.
- MBR est facile à comprendre et à utiliser pour gérer les partitions de base.
- Il peut toujours être utilisé sur des ordinateurs dotés d’un micrologiciel BIOS sans avoir besoin de UEFI mode.
Inconvénients du MBR
- MBR ne peut gérer que jusqu’à 2TB de stockage, de sorte que les disques plus volumineux ne peuvent pas être entièrement utilisés sans les convertir en GPT.
- Si vous souhaitez créer plus de 4 partitions, vous devez utiliser un extended partition, ce qui est plus compliqué par rapport aux partitions dans GPT.
- Si MBR secteur est corrompu ou perdu, toutes les données du disque peuvent devenir inaccessibles (unbootable disk).
Qu’est-ce que GPT (GUID Partition Table) ?
GPT (GUID Partition Table) est une norme de partition moderne qui remplace MBR (Master Boot Record) pour améliorer la flexibilité, la sécurité et l’évolutivité dans la gestion du stockage de données.
Contrairement au MBR, qui stocke les informations de partition dans le premier secteur du disque, GPT utilise des structures de données dispersées sur plusieurs parties du disque pour améliorer la fiabilité et la redondance. De plus, GPT peut être utilisé sur des périphériques de stockage d’une capacité de plus de 2 To, et prend en charge jusqu’à 128 partitions sur un seul disque, bien plus que MBR qui ne prend en charge que 4 partitions primaires.
GPT ne peut être utilisé que sur des systèmes qui prennent en charge UEFI (Unified Extensible Firmware Interface), contrairement à MBR qui peut fonctionner sur des systèmes basés sur Legacy BIOS.
GPT a été introduit pour la première fois dans le cadre de l’UEFI Specification pour remplacer MBR, qui a des limitations dans le nombre de partitions et la taille de stockage. Au fur et à mesure que la technologie de stockage d’une capacité supérieure à 2TB se développe, GPT est devenu la principale norme de partition utilisée dans les systèmes d’exploitation modernes tels que Windows 10/11, macOS et Linux.
Les systèmes d’exploitation qui prennent en charge GPT sont les suivants :
- Windows (Windows 8, 10, 11) – Il est obligatoire d’utiliser GPT pour démarrer en mode UEFI.
- MacOS – Tous les appareils Mac utilisent GPT par défaut.
- Linux (Ubuntu, Fedora, Debian,etc.) – Prend en charge GPT avec les systèmes de démarrage UEFI et Legacy Mode (avec quelques configurations supplémentaires).
Structure principale de GPT
GPT a une structure plus complexe que MBR, avec plusieurs composants clés :
1. Primary GPT Header
- Situé à LBA 1 (adresse de bloc logique 1).
- Contient des informations sur le disque, y compris l’emplacement et le nombre de partitions.
- Il dispose d’CRC32 checksum, qui est utilisé pour vérifier l’intégrité des données.
2.Partition Table
- Stockez les entrées de partition qui peuvent contenir jusqu’à 128 partitions sur un seul disque.
- Chaque entrée dispose d’un GUID unique pour identifier le type de partition (par exemple, Windows, Linux, macOS).
3. Backup GPT Header
- Situé à la fin du disque en tant que sauvegarde de Primary GPT Header.
- Il sert de mécanisme de récupération si Primary GPT Header est endommagé ou corrompu.